Message type: E = Error
Message class: QE - RM-QSS Fehlertexte zur Ergebniserfassung
Message number: 761
Message text: System determines start of inspection
You entered an inspection start on the initial screen of results
recording. However, the inspection lot was only created later on and no
results were recorded for at least one characteristic.
The system uses the system date or time as the start of the inspection
for these characteristics.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
